bivCH. Morris Good Morning Mona, ROM
8/04/88 - 10/24/01

Sire: Shiloh-Guardian Still Smokin | Dam: Super Sweet Sabrina Selah
28" - 120 lbs | dark black/cream plush

Mona sits very prominently in the history of the Shiloh Shepherd with many pedigrees tracing back to her. Registered as an AKC German Shepherd prior to being registered as Shiloh Shepherd after the breed became recognized as a Rare Breed in 1991, Mona was bred by Alice Fisher of Selah Shepherds.

Mona was very typical of an “old world-style” German Shepherd. She was oversized (above standard) huge boned, huge headed with a huge, square body and an unwavering sense of loyalty, protection, and at all times, very trustworthy and gentle.
